Management Commentary

During the recent Q1 2026 earnings call, Duke Energy’s management highlighted the utility’s solid start to the year, driven by continued regulatory progress and steady customer growth. The company reported earnings per share of $1.93, supported by strong operational performance across its regulated utilities and improved weather-related demand compared to the prior-year period. Executives noted that ongoing investments in grid modernization and renewable energy projects are advancing on schedule, positioning the company to meet its long-term clean energy targets while maintaining reliability for customers. Management emphasized that constructive regulatory outcomes in key states, including new rate cases and infrastructure cost recovery mechanisms, would likely provide a stable foundation for future earnings. Operational highlights included the successful completion of major transmission upgrades and the expansion of solar generation capacity in the Carolinas. The team also pointed to disciplined cost management and efficiency initiatives that helped offset inflationary pressures in labor and materials. Looking ahead, the leadership expressed confidence in the company’s ability to execute its capital plan, though they noted potential headwinds from interest rate volatility and evolving environmental regulations. Overall, the commentary reflected a focus on operational excellence and regulatory alignment, with an emphasis on delivering consistent value to shareholders and customers alike. Forward Guidance

Duke Energy’s forward guidance, provided alongside its recently released Q1 2026 results, emphasizes a measured approach to growth amid regulatory and operational developments. Management reiterated its full-year 2026 adjusted EPS outlook, which the company expects to land within a range consistent with its long-term target of 5% to 7% annual earnings-per-share growth, based on the $1.93 reported for the first quarter. The utility anticipates that continued investment in grid modernization, renewable energy projects, and battery storage will underpin this trajectory, though outcomes may be influenced by pending rate case decisions and weather patterns. The company highlighted its five-year capital expenditure plan, projecting potential spending in the range of $80 billion to $85 billion through 2030, with a focus on reliability and clean energy transitions. Duke Energy also noted that customer growth in its service territories, particularly in the Southeast, could provide a tailwind for future earnings, but cautioned that regulatory lag and financing costs might temper near-term margin expansion. No specific numerical guidance for Q2 or the remainder of 2026 was provided beyond reaffirming the annual outlook, and management signaled that updates would be shared as regulatory proceedings progress. Overall, the tone remains one of cautious optimism, with growth expectations tied closely to execution on capital projects and constructive regulatory outcomes. Market Reaction

Duke Energy’s Q1 2026 earnings release, with an actual EPS of $1.93, prompted a relatively muted initial market response as investors weighed the results against broader sector trends. In the hours following the announcement, shares experienced modest upward pressure, though trading volume remained within normal ranges. Analysts noted that the reported earnings were in line with elevated seasonal expectations, leading some to describe the performance as steady rather than spectacular. Several firms reiterated neutral stances, citing that while Duke’s regulated utility model provides revenue stability, the absence of a revenue figure in the release left uncertainty regarding top-line growth momentum. The stock price’s reaction suggests investors are focusing on long-term capital expenditure plans and rate case outcomes rather than any single quarterly performance. Some analysts pointed to potential tailwinds from data center demand and grid modernization, indicating that Duke’s positioning could support earnings trajectories, but they cautioned that near-term volatility may persist as market participants await further clarity on regulatory decisions. Overall, the market reaction reflects a cautious optimism, with the stock holding relatively steady as investors digest the implications for the remainder of the fiscal year.
